Indoor vs. Outdoor: Where Will Your Fan Live?
The first step is determining where you'll be installing your wall fan. If it's for a patio or damp bathroom, you'll need a damp-rated model. These are specifically designed to withstand moisture without corroding or malfunctioning. For indoor use, you have more flexibility, but still consider the room's purpose. A bedroom might benefit from a quiet, energy-efficient model, while a living room could accommodate a larger, more decorative fan.
Consider a model with a light if you need to add illumination to the space. Many options are available with dimmable lights, allowing you to control the ambiance. A wall fan with light is a great way to consolidate your lighting and cooling needs.
Style and Finish: Matching Your Decor
Once you've addressed the practical considerations, it's time to think about style. Wall fans come in a wide range of finishes and designs to complement any decor.
Modern: Look for sleek, minimalist designs in finishes like brushed nickel, black, or white. These fans often feature clean lines and simple blades. A Kichler white wall fan modern is a great option for contemporary spaces.
Traditional: Consider models with ornate details, decorative blades, and finishes like bronze or brass. These fans often have a more classic and elegant look.
Coastal: Opt for fans with light, airy designs and finishes like white, brushed nickel, or distressed wood. These fans often incorporate nautical elements like rope or woven textures.
Farmhouse/Rustic: Choose fans with rustic finishes like bronze or oil-rubbed bronze, and consider models with wooden blades.

Q: How can a wall fan enhance the ambiance of my living space?
A: Wall fans offer a fantastic way to circulate air, creating a more comfortable and refreshing atmosphere. Their streamlined design can also add a touch of modern elegance to any room, blending seamlessly with your existing decor.
Q: Are wall fans suitable for smaller rooms or apartments?
A: Absolutely! Wall fans are a brilliant space-saving solution. By mounting them on the wall, you free up valuable floor space while still enjoying a powerful and efficient cooling effect. They're perfect for maximizing comfort in compact areas.
Q: What advantages do wall fans offer compared to other types of fans?
A: Wall fans provide directed airflow, allowing you to focus the cooling effect exactly where you need it. This makes them incredibly efficient and effective at keeping you comfortable. Plus, they are often out of reach of children and pets for added safety.
